Transaction 31450e23a164939943f741392acbd3c4d8de80432acb6148d980c52030e2d4a3
1 Input
1 Output
-
31450e23a164939943f741392acbd3c4d8de80432acb6148d980c52030e2d4a3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 38a1f7938d987c261e83fdfa3985ab42bd9fa6b5585563f359ae67a939995314
- address
- bc1p8zsl0yudnp7zv85rlharnpdtg27elf44tp2k8u6e4en6jwve2v2qngmuec